Hey jeff! I am a member of a group that has claims around barstow. We have found gold in washes coming off hillsides. Ive wondered where is this gold coming from. Its chunky so it hasnt travled very far. There is quartz float everywhere on top of these hills but no vein in sight. Is this a huge flood plane that left all this material? Maybe you could do a short video on this area so we can better follow the clues.
The bull quartz IS your vein indicator. All the mineralization has been weathered out, so all the mineral values are below ground. If you have float, you have veins. You just have to find it.

People overlook the fact that some waterfalls are seasonal from rainstorms in a monsoon season. While not there at all in other seasons. People skipped and walked right past a dry place in wrong season. People couldn’t even travel to certain remote places if no water is around. Can only go there in winter time. It rains and makes waterfalls etc. At other times of year not a drop of water

Native of AZ here, the western deserts of az can get hotter than a 2 peckered billiegoat. Watch out for snakes in the shade and in the mine entrances. Just because the sun goes down doesnt mean your safe from the critters. Remember, in the southwest deserts, every critter becomes nocturnal. Watch out for scorpions and centipedes flipping rocks. And dont forget about those dam black widow spiders they can ruin your day.
